Let's be honest, summertime as a mama and juggling your business or working full time is tough. It's tough mentally, but also scheudling-wise. You want to be present for everything, be the "FUN" mom who is saying yes and creating this magical summer for your kids.

Thanks to the ever- present reminder from social media of just how short our summers with our kids are, it puts so much pressure on us to lay everything down and just do all the things to keep our kids entertained and make every memory magical.

But with the right balance in the way of structure and routine it can start to suffocate you a little.

I will be the first to tell you that I thrive off of routine and in the summer it's nice to be a little more lax about our daily schedule. However, too much lax makes my kids LAZY and lack motivation to achieve even the simplest of things.

What I came up with for my family is simple, but effective and includes things like daily habits that they NEED to accomplish for basic hygiene and care. I then added in some other things that they get credit for- like scripture memory, one lesson a day to keep their brains active, one chore a day from a chore jar with age appropriate chores and encourages behaviors that care for the things they have, like cleaning their rooms daily.

Maybe this is for you, maybe it's not but I hope you find this episode encouraging this summer as you shift the way you work, the way you mom and accomplish daily things so that you can enjoy summer without feeling overwhelmed to have it all together. Some things will get set to the side and that's 100% expected unless you have a team behind you!

If you are a mama, you understand that there is this invisible load of motherhood.

It is existential, and it's never ending!

This is that always going on in your mind, the To-do list that keeps you up at 2:00 AM makes it hard to go to sleep.

You're thinking, how am I ever going to get all of these things done?

We're afraid to ask for help. We're overwhelmed at the same time.

If we talk about it, we're complaining. Does that make you exhausted?

Just listening to that? Cause that makes me exhausted!

So how do we break out of this invisible load of motherhood?

  1. Designate days to get things done- chores, to- dos, honey-dos,
  2. Invite your kids to participate in whatever needs to be done- this includes helping prep meals, clean up their rooms, clean up toys, bring laundry to the laundry room. Anything you have on your to-do list that you kids can help with (its' more than you probably are letting them help with currently).
  3. Have conversations with your spouse if you're married, that are SPECIFIC to easing the load that's on your plate. Men typically want to help you be less stressed they simply are just LOST on what would actually make a difference.
  4. Get in community with other women! This has been SUCH AN INTEGRAL PART of this season of my motherhood success. It takes a village isn't just a saying... It's a way of life! I couldn't do what I do without the women in my community either trading services, time, childcare, goods etc... It has made a TREMENDOUS impact in my life and business.

Stop feeling guilty about what you "should" do. You should do exactly what you feel called to doing. This is your life, your journey and how you want to do it should not be a topic of discussion for anyone except for the people inside of your home.

Building a course is a work of art! It takes time, honing your skill and being able to deliver it in a way that your audience can consume it, engage with it and GET RESULTS! So lets dive into the process a bit!

  1. What is your goal with the course? What results do you hope that your clients will see by applying your method, framework or program?
  2. Who are you trying to attract? What are their pain points?
  3. What are the solutions that you offer? Is there clarity around what results you are offering & want them to get?
  4. How long, how much & when? Launching can get hectic so just keep it simple! How long is the course, how much are you charging & when does it start?
  5. Do the do. Don’t let fear of failure or not being perfect keep you from launching your signature program this year!
